DESCRIPTION:The Association is pleased to announce that our September event is a visit to John Binns & Son (Springs) Ltd. Skipton. \nEstablished in 1895 as John Binns & Son (Springs) Ltd\, the JB Group has witnessed many changes in the manufacturing landscape over the last 128 years. Remaining a family-run company to this day\, they now proudly operate from purpose-built premises equipped with the latest technologies in the production of springs and wire forms and custom parts across a wide range of industries and sectors. \nBook your places with John Pankhurst at kaoe2022@gmail.com 07582 822922 \nAddress: John Binns & Son (Springs) Ltd. DESCRIPTION:The Keighley Association of Engineers is pleased to announce its May 2024 event\, a talk by Martin Lunn M.B.E. on “Hidden under the Carpet”. \nMartin is a renowned local speaker. His talk will follow the forgotten story of Edward Crossley and Joseph Gledhill of Crossley Carpets. \nCrossley Carpets made carpets which were exported around the world. What is less well known is that Edward Crossley and his employed assistant astronomer Joseph Gledhill had an observatory with the largest reflecting telescope in England. The two  astronomers made massive contributions to the study of astronomy and after their deaths\, Crossley’s two big telescopes\, the 36 inch Common reflector and the 9.3 inch Cooke refractor\, continued to be used in astronomical research. \nGuests are most welcome to attend. DESCRIPTION:The Keighley Association of Engineers is pleased to announce our April event in our 2023 syllabus\, a visit to Allerton Waste Recovery Park\, Knaresborough. \nAllerton Waste Recovery Park is a state-of-the-art centre where we will see the present and the future of recycling a wide variety of waste. \nAllerton Waste Recovery Park is a state-of-the-art facility treating ‘black bag’ waste from households across the county. \nThe site became operational in March 2018 and employs 90 local people. Through a unique combination of three technologies\, it is reducing the amount of household waste from North Yorkshire being sent to landfill by at least 90%. \nThis is done by: \n\nSorting ‘black bag’ waste using mechanical treatment technology to extract and recycle items.\nProcessing around 40\,000 tonnes of food and organic waste each year to generate renewable energy.\nUsing the remaining non-recyclable waste to generate enough energy to power at least 40\,000 homes.\n\nPlease let John McCluskey know you are coming by Friday 14th April to assist with planning (this is open to ladies/guests) at jjmccluskey@btopenworld.com 07585 126503 \nYou can see much more about Allerton Park on their website \nView the flyer for the visit to Allerton Waster Recovery Park
